This car was originally n/a. The previous owner turbo'ed the stock ej22e with no engine management. When that motor died, I took another ej22e open deck block and rebuilt it.

The block:

ej22e open deck
cleaned
honed
new clevite main and rod bearings
stock ej22t turbo pistons
moly coated piston rings

The longblock:

ej25 dohc heads/manifold
cometic ej22t head gaskets
stock sensors, etc...
2006 wrx top mount intercooler and blow off valve
Cold air intake (Stock box included with sale)
ej22t higher output waterpump and oil pump
new timing belt
t3 turbo in need of replacement

Exhaust:

99rs manifold
2" stainless uppipe
2.5" stainless downpipe
sti midpipe
sti exhaust


ECU:

Stock ecu
Apexi SAFC II
J&S safeguard Ultra
Zeitronix Wideband (needs a new cable)
I have 5 gauges that go with the car.
Mechanical boost (installed)
Electric oil temp (installed)
Electric oil pressure
Electric EGT
Electric fuel pressure (installed)


Suspension:

rs struts
stock springs
18mm rear sway bar
powerflex swaybar bushings

Drivetrain:

3.90 tranny (has a very slow leak)
Exedy organic street clutch with a lot of miles left
wrx rims and stock re92s or dunlops (I have 2 sets of rims and Im keeping one set)
Short throw shifter and sti bushing.
3.90 rear LSD

Brakes

wrx front and rear calipers
wrx front and rear rotors
goodridge stainless brake lines

Other:

wrx fuel pump
hitch and wiring


This car RUNS and is driveable.



The bad:

The windshield is cracked
The drivers side fender is dented
Theres some rust at the rear wheel wells (more than some on pass side)
Rear quarter panel has some solid but ugly bodywork
Turbo is starting to die

AND, this car has a slow tranny fluid leak...


Like I said before, the car runs and drives. It could use a tune, and it needs a turbo rebuild or replacement.
